Discover Waverly, VALocation and OverviewWaverly, VA, a welcoming town in Sussex County, offers small-town charm near the crossroads of U.S. Route 460 and State Route 40. History and HeritageFounded along historic rail lines, Waverly, Virginia preserves its heritage through landmarks, churches, and stories tied to agriculture and timber. Outdoor RecreationOutdoor enthusiasts enjoy nearby hunting lands, scenic byways, and easy drives to Chippokes State Park, the Nottoway River, and Petersburg National Battlefield. Local Businesses and DiningA modest downtown corridor features local restaurants, service businesses, and everyday conveniences that anchor Waverly?s economy. Community and EventsThe community spirit shows at seasonal festivals, youth sports, and church gatherings that bring neighbors together. Education and ServicesFamilies are served by Sussex County Public Schools and area healthcare providers, with larger medical centers accessible in Petersburg and Richmond. Real Estate and LivingReal estate in Waverly, VA ranges from historic homes and rural acreage to new builds, offering affordable options for first-time buyers and retirees. Transportation and AccessCommuters value the straight-shot travel on U.S. 460, plus connections to I-95 and I-295 for broader Virginia and Mid-Atlantic travel.
